aboutsummaryrefslogtreecommitdiff
path: root/client/map/tile_factory.gd
diff options
context:
space:
mode:
authormetamuffin <metamuffin@disroot.org>2024-06-25 15:22:03 +0200
committermetamuffin <metamuffin@disroot.org>2024-06-25 15:22:03 +0200
commitf961c1f8d25f479d8b91ac537f3a91ab0adc68b1 (patch)
treefaf6a3297bdaa449b70a18db8e0d1d2132b99dd0 /client/map/tile_factory.gd
parentfb063266454462571596931b40560bf3992f7f16 (diff)
parent4c6b38bb85d5211df01ee4f9e14a613dbe21be6d (diff)
downloadhurrycurry-f961c1f8d25f479d8b91ac537f3a91ab0adc68b1.tar
hurrycurry-f961c1f8d25f479d8b91ac537f3a91ab0adc68b1.tar.bz2
hurrycurry-f961c1f8d25f479d8b91ac537f3a91ab0adc68b1.tar.zst
Merge branch 'master' of codeberg.org:metamuffin/undercooked
Diffstat (limited to 'client/map/tile_factory.gd')
-rw-r--r--client/map/tile_factory.gd6
1 files changed, 5 insertions, 1 deletions
diff --git a/client/map/tile_factory.gd b/client/map/tile_factory.gd
index bbd6e52f..9869270d 100644
--- a/client/map/tile_factory.gd
+++ b/client/map/tile_factory.gd
@@ -16,7 +16,7 @@
class_name TileFactory
extends Object
-static func produce(tile_name: String, node_name: String, neighbors: Array) -> Floor:
+static func produce(tile_name: String, node_name: String, neighbors: Array) -> Tile:
match tile_name:
"trash":
return Trash.new(node_name, neighbors)
@@ -52,6 +52,10 @@ static func produce(tile_name: String, node_name: String, neighbors: Array) -> F
return Door.new(node_name, neighbors)
"leek-crate":
return LeekCrate.new(node_name, neighbors)
+ "tree":
+ return ExteriorTree.new(node_name, neighbors)
+ "grass":
+ return Grass.new(node_name, neighbors)
var t:
push_warning("tile tile %s unknown" % t)
return GenericTile.new(node_name, neighbors, t)